This comfy caravan rental is located near Port Augusta, and is perfect for up to four guests who want to enjoy a relaxing weekend getaway in South Australia. There's a double bed inside, as well as two twin beds ideal for children. Bedding and linens are available to hire. A short walk away is the shared bathroom with a shower and toilet.

There's a lounge area for guests to relax in, and a fully equipped kitchen to prepare your meals, as well as a BBQ outside. There's also a campfire to light up and gather around underneath the starry sky. The campervan rental is located on a working farm so there may be cattle of horses in the paddocks nearby.

This scenic camping hut rental is settled on a working farm, nestled among deep gorges and stunning mountain ranges in South Australia. Access to the hut is by 4x4 or hiking from the homestead. The farm has paddocks with cattle and horses. Glampers will find themselves at the base of Mount Brown, in the Flinders Ranges, the largest mountain range in South Australia. The small, former seaport of Port Augusta is only 20 minutes away from Catninga. Glampers can also access the Northern Flinders Ranges and hike the Heysen Trail. Adelaide, South Australia’s coastal capital is only 3 & 1/2 hours drive away, where guests can find fine dine restaurants, shops, cafes, and bars. Guests should be sure to explore the city's bustling Adelaide Central Market, the Adelaide Botanic Garden, and the Art Gallery of South Australia.

Catninga is in the middle, between the Southern and Northern Flinders Ranges, so there is plenty to do and see. Take a day trip to Wilpena Pound or Blinman to the north, or Melrose or Laura to the South. Catninga is also only a short drive to Port Augusta's Arid Land Botanic Gardens, or a beautiful sandy beach. Alternatively, just sit and relax surrounded by beauty.
